Highly-rated son of NBA great includes Rutgers in latest list of schools he is considering
Rutgers remains in the race for the son of an NBA great. The Scarlet Knights are one of the six schools that Kiyan Anthony, a four-star shooting guard in the 2025 recruiting class, included in his latest list after he narrowed his options, the prospect announced Thursday. Steve Pikiell’s program is joined by Syracuse, Auburn, USC, Ohio State and Florida State.
TE Ben Rothhaar flips commitment to Rutgers
Rutgers landed another commitment in the class of 2025 today when Ben Rothhaar of Norwalk (Ohio) announced his plans to join the Scarlet Knights. The 6-foot-5, 210-pounder was previously committed to Kent State but has flipped to Rutgers. Rothhaar becomes the 30th commitment to the Rutgers 2025 class as he joined the program on a day when the staff was hosting an unofficial visitor barbecue for members of the class of 2026. The class of 2025 commits are expected to be on campus tomorrow.

This ‘little gem’ of a tennis court in N.J. just marked a milestone moment
In a residential area between two houses, hidden by trees and big shrubs, is a secluded tennis court where members of the Hilltop Tennis Club have played for a century. This tennis club is one of the few places in Fanwood where members can play on a softer, Har-Tru (clay) surface.

10-Year-Old Cranford Girl Running in the USATF Junior Olympics
CRANFORD, NJ – Sandra Jakubuik always loved to run around with her friends. She was so quick, her parents asked if she wanted to join the Westfield Area YMCA Flyers Track Club in September 2023. By December, she had qualified and ran in the Junior Olympics in Kentucky. “I love running because it keeps me active,” Jakubuik told TAPinto Cranford. “And it challenges me to be better.” Sandra set her club record this season by running the 3000m race in 12:07 at the regional meet in the girls 11-12 age group (she doesn’t turn 11 until September, but it’s determined by birth year).
